Fixing function arguments

The harmonic mean function is almost complete. However, you still need to provide some checks on the na.rm argument. This time, rather than throwing errors when the input is in an incorrect form, you are going to try to fix it.

na.rm should be a logical vector with one element (that is, TRUE, or FALSE).
